A coworker of mine is going to have her first baby and we're not sure whether it will be a boy or a girl yet. Because I generally take forever to get anything done, I figured it would be a good idea to start sooner rather than later, which left me deciding on how to go gender-neutral for her quilt.
I asked her about her favorite colors/themes and she said turquoise, blue, green, and BUGS! I've been working on taming scraps for the past few weeks, so I decided to go with a super-scrappy and use up some 2.5" squares. The bug fabric will be in the center of all squares (scraps inherited from a past coworker's mother) and I'll probably sash with a solid or tone-on-tone turquoise with cornerstones. That way I can surround the whole thing with a turquoise border. There will be 20 squares total.
Do you think this looks gender-neutral enough? Not too girl and not too boy?
